Ubuntu 18.04 LTS对比20.04 LTS?

结论:Ubuntu 20.04 LTS 在性能、安全性和用户体验上均优于 Ubuntu 18.04 LTS,尤其是在硬件支持、软件更新和桌面环境优化方面表现更为出色。 对于新用户或需要长期支持的用户,建议直接选择 20.04 LTS;而对于已经运行 18.04 LTS 的用户,如果系统稳定且满足需求,可以暂缓升级,但长期来看,升级到 20.04 LTS 是更优选择。

1. 性能与硬件支持

  • Ubuntu 20.04 LTS 在性能上进行了显著优化,尤其是在启动速度和资源占用方面表现更好。 20.04 版本采用了更新的内核(Linux 5.4),对新型硬件的支持更加完善,包括最新的 CPU、GPU 和网络设备。相比之下,18.04 LTS 的内核版本较旧,可能无法充分发挥新硬件的性能。
  • 20.04 LTS 还引入了 ZFS 文件系统的官方支持,这对于需要高可靠性和数据完整性的用户来说是一个重要的改进。 18.04 LTS 虽然也支持 ZFS,但需要手动安装和配置,不如 20.04 那样开箱即用。

2. 安全性与更新

  • Ubuntu 20.04 LTS 在安全性方面进行了多项增强,包括默认启用的安全启动和更严格的软件包签名验证。 这些改进使得系统在启动和运行过程中更加安全,减少了潜在的安全威胁。
  • 20.04 LTS 还提供了更频繁的安全更新和补丁,确保系统在长期使用过程中保持安全。 相比之下,18.04 LTS 虽然仍然在支持期内,但由于时间的推移,其安全更新的频率和范围可能会逐渐减少。

3. 桌面环境与用户体验

  • Ubuntu 20.04 LTS 默认使用 GNOME 3.36 桌面环境,相比 18.04 LTS 的 GNOME 3.28,在界面设计和用户体验上有了显著提升。 20.04 的桌面更加流畅,动画效果更加自然,同时还引入了新的主题和图标集,整体视觉效果更加现代。
  • 20.04 LTS 还改进了多显示器支持和触摸屏体验,使得在多种设备上的使用更加便捷。 18.04 LTS 虽然也支持这些功能,但在细节和稳定性上不如 20.04。

4. 软件生态与兼容性

  • Ubuntu 20.04 LTS 提供了更新的软件包和工具链,包括 Python 3.8、GCC 9.3 等,这对于开发者和需要最新软件功能的用户来说是一个重要的优势。 18.04 LTS 的软件包相对较旧,可能无法满足某些新应用或开发需求。
  • 20.04 LTS 还改进了 Snap 和 Flatpak 的支持,使得安装和管理第三方应用更加方便。 18.04 LTS 虽然也支持这些技术,但在集成度和用户体验上不如 20.04。

5. 升级与迁移

  • 对于已经运行 Ubuntu 18.04 LTS 的用户,升级到 20.04 LTS 是一个相对平滑的过程,但需要确保备份重要数据并检查硬件兼容性。 20.04 LTS 提供了详细的升级指南和工具,帮助用户顺利完成迁移。
  • 对于新用户或需要长期支持的用户,直接选择 20.04 LTS 是更明智的选择,因为它提供了更好的性能、安全性和用户体验。 18.04 LTS 虽然仍然稳定,但在长期支持期内可能会逐渐落后于 20.04。

总结:Ubuntu 20.04 LTS 在多个方面都优于 18.04 LTS,尤其是在性能、安全性和用户体验上表现更为出色。 对于新用户或需要长期支持的用户,建议直接选择 20.04 LTS;而对于已经运行 18.04 LTS 的用户,如果系统稳定且满足需求,可以暂缓升级,但长期来看,升级到 20.04 LTS 是更优选择。

未经允许不得转载:ECLOUD博客 » Ubuntu 18.04 LTS对比20.04 LTS?